Output 59bf606f36fa7fde2e75ac47293c92e200670e74f6537bef7ed30e8fe587032d:1

value
23710104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e42856700bf33aa8f783e3c9c6e3a2a6fc76a10b OP_EQUAL
address
MUhYcsnR2NJX8SbSRw7V6hwq75RKZUhZQq
transaction
59bf606f36fa7fde2e75ac47293c92e200670e74f6537bef7ed30e8fe587032d
spent
true